    Overview for Sterling 35548 TriTech Climbing Kernmantle Rope, Dyneema/Nylon/Technora, 7/16" D, 8,140 lbs., Per Foot

    The Sterling TriTech Climbing Kernmantle Rope is a reliable static line used by arborists and work professionals for SRT climbing, light rigging, and rappelling applications. It has a unique design that works well with other climbing equipment, and it offers high-cut resistance and non-conductive property. Abrasion resistant, great knot holding capability, and is great as a positioning lanyard, this Sterling rope is a versatile, tough, and durable product that tree professionals love.

    High-Quality & Durable Design: This Sterling TriTech Rope is made of a kernmantle construction, which resists flattening and glazing during use, has a standard diameter of 7/16" (11mm), thick enough for a comfortable grip while in use, and is sold per foot depending on the needs of the user. It has a heavy duty Technora sheath, a Dyneema inner jacket, and an energy absorbing nylon core, making it very strong, rugged, and flexible enough for an easy movement and positioning. This climbing rope has a value of 8,140lbs. for its tensile strength, which indicates that the rope could take multiple falls and can be used for heavy loads.
